己糖激酶法测定血清葡萄糖的技术性能评价  

Evaluation and Study of the Technical Property of the Method of Hexokinase for Assay of Serum Glucose

摘  要:目的:对HK法测定血清葡萄糖的技术性能进行评价。方法:采用HK法进行精密度试验、回收试验、线性试验、干扰试验,并与GOD-POD偶联法进行比较。结果:HK法批内CV为1.28%,批间CV为1.91%,日间CV为2.20%,总CV为2.74%;平均回收率为99.12%;线性上限可达30mmol/L;抗胆红素和维生素C干扰的能力均较强;没有发现高浓度的钩状效应;与GOD-POD偶联法的测定结果无显著性差异(P>0.05),有良好的相关性(Y=1.0192X-0.3135,r=0.9882)。结论:HK法是临床测定血清葡萄糖较理想的方法。Objective : To evaluate and study of the technical property of the method of hexokinase for Assay of serum glucose. Methods it was performed that the precision test, recovery test, linear test and interference test for the hexokinase method. Results: with in run and between run CV of hexokinase method was 1.28% and 1.91%, and the between day CV was 2. 20% and total CV was 2.74% respectively. The average rate of recovery of hexokinase method was 99. 12% , and the upper limit of liner can reach to 30mmol/L. It can significantly against interfere with the bilirubin and vitamin C. In higher concentration of hexokinase, we have not found hook effect. There was significantly correlated with method of GOD - POD cross - coupling ( Y = 1. 0192X - 0. 3135, r = 0. 9882) and had no significant difference between them ( P 〉 0. 05 ) . Conclusions : Hexokinase method is an effective way to assay serum glueose.
